Nations Royalty increases private placement to C$13 million

January 15, 2026 7:00 PM EST

Nations Royalty Corp. (TSXV: NRC) announced it has increased the size of its previously announced private placement from C$10 million to C$13 million due to strong investor demand.



The company will issue 8.125 million units at C$1.60 per unit through underwriters Red Cloud Securities Inc. and Canaccord Genuity Corp. Each unit consists of one common share and one-half warrant, with each full warrant exercisable at C$2.25 for 36 months after closing.



The underwriters have an option to purchase an additional 1.25 million units for up to C$2 million in additional proceeds. The offering is scheduled to close on January 30, 2026, subject to regulatory approvals including TSX Venture Exchange approval.



Nations Royalty will pay the underwriters a 6% cash commission on gross proceeds and issue warrants equal to 6% of units sold, exercisable for 36 months at the offering price.



The company intends to use net proceeds for acquisitions of royalties, income and commodity streams, annual benefit payments and working capital purposes.



The units will be offered in Canada under the listed issuer financing exemption, with shares expected to be immediately tradeable. The securities will also be offered in the United States through private placement exemptions and in other jurisdictions on a private placement basis.



Nations Royalty focuses on combining royalties and benefit payment entitlements from resource projects while building Indigenous capacity in public companies and capital markets. The company currently holds annual benefit payment entitlements from five properties in Canada, including the Brucejack gold mine operated by Newmont Corporation.
